Congress workers demonstrated on Sunday against the Union Budget 2021-22 and fuel price hike. During this, he showed black flags to Union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man who visited Mumbai. However, the police stopped the protesters from approaching the place where the Finance Minister was supposed to go.
A police official said that as soon as the Union minister reached the Yogi Sabha home in the Dadar area to discuss the Union Budget presented last week, around 400 to 500 activists of the Congress started shouting slogans against him.
Congress workers also raised slogans praising their party leader Rahul Gandhi. The official said that the protesters started gathering outside Dadar railway station in the early hours.
He also raised slogans against the Union Budget and an increase in rail fares along with essential items like petrol, diesel, cooking gas cylinders. Deputy Commissioner of Police (Zone-4) Vijay Patil said the protest was peaceful. No untoward incident has been reported, nor has anyone been detained.
